    A Predictive Approach for the Flammability Limits of Methane-Nitrogen Mixtures

    Source: Journal of Energy Resources Technology:;1990:;volume( 112 ):;issue: 004::page 251
    Author:
    I. Wierzba
    ,
    G. A. Karim
    DOI: 10.1115/1.2905768
    Publisher: The American Society of Mechanical Engineers (ASME)
    Abstract: The present contribution describes a relatively simple procedure for predicting the lean and rich flammability limits of methane-nitrogen mixtures in air from a knowledge of the composition of the fuel mixture and the corresponding limit for methane. It is shown that this approach can be extended similarly to consider the limits of natural gas-nitrogen mixtures yielding relatively good agreement with experimental values over a relatively wide range of composition and pressure.
